How they compare
Iceland currently reports 18,795 GWh against 17,207 GWh in Mozambique, a difference of 1,588 GWh.
That makes Iceland's figure about 1.1 times Mozambique's.
The two have swapped places 4 times across 26 shared years of data; in 1990 it was Iceland ahead.
Iceland ranks 36th and Mozambique ranks 37th of 230 countries.
Across the 3 decades both report, Iceland averaged higher in 2 and Mozambique in 1.

About this data
Renewable energy electricity output (GWh): Total number of GWh generated by renewable power plants, including wind, solar PV, solar thermal, hydro, marine, geothermal, biomass, renewable municipal waste, liquid biofuels and biogas. Electricity production for hydro pumpted storage is excluded.
